Nets Seem to Be Standing Pat on Deadline Day
With less than three hours to go until the NBA’s trading deadline, all indications from the national and local media is that the Brooklyn Nets will not make any significant moves. Obviously, that could change, as all it takes is a single phone call and a general manager or two with an itchy trigger finger to change that.
